  4. Ok so I ended up experimenting with the touch-up paint from Subaru. On the smaller stuff it works great, and on scratches. On the larger chip you can see it does not match perfectly but its pretty darn close. Using the Turtle wax scratch remover kit makes the chips disappear completely. So rejoice, there is some hope after all for us SPW scoobie owners. Ill take pics later and show the work.

  7. So for a few months I have been researching on different forums for what is the best touch up paint for the tricolor "satin pearl white," with little to no good idea. My goal is to find a near perfect match to the original paint. This is only a temporary solution because late in the summer I am going to completely repaint the front fender, the hood, and the rear with the SPW. Sadly I just do not have the time or expense to do it now and it looks bad. Has anyone ever fixed chips in this color before from Subaru? If so please help. I dont want to drop the money on a product that will look so off you can spot it from arms length away. Also, has anyone every used dr. colorchip with this color? We just used it to fix a few scratches in my friends red Prius and it was a perfect match.
